Modified gross leases typically require tenants to pay for utilities, … WebOct 14, 2024 · CAM reconciliation generally happens at the end of the year or the beginning of the following year. At that time, the landlord provides a reporting of all the expenses incurred during the year. The tenant has a responsibility to cover their portion of the building expenses for the year.

CAM stands for common area maintenance, and CAM charges often appear in commercial leases for spaces in multi-tenant business parks.
